paris, Here's a snippet from the mcubed site: > Fans: My Papst fan 4412 runs up and down? which defers the tacho signal. With a PWM frequence over 100 the tacho signal will get lost. Please set the PWM frequence under 100 (optimal between 80 and 85) and it runs stable with tacho signal. In my person...

use the hitachi feature tool on the ultimatebootcd if the samsung app doesn't work out for you. Doesn't matter that its not made by samsung, the application will still work to enable/disable AAM.
